Luxol make flying start with Super Cup success

Champions Luxol St Andrews began the 2017/18 futsal season on a flying note after winning the Super Cup at the expense of Ħamrun Tre Angeli on Thursday.  The final, played in front of a sizeable crowd at the Corradino Sports Pavilion, was an entertaining affair as both teams showed a high level of play but Luxol were clearly the better side to cruise to a 9-3 victory. Ħamrun enjoyed a strong start as captain Jason Mifsud opened the scoring after only five seconds. A minute and a half later, Rogerio Dos Santos, who was facing his former team-mates, made it 1-1.  Luxol gained control and goals from Emil Raducu, Glenn Bonello and George Frendo gave them a 4-1 lead going into the half-time break. Inside the first two minutes of the second half, Rogerio Dos Santos scored a brace to all but seal Luxol’s win. Everton Dos Santos responded with a brace of his own to narrow the deficit for Ħamrun Tre Angeli but there was no easing up from Luxol who pulled further clear with strikes from Emil Raducu, Mark Zammit and Zvezdan Vukovic. At the end of the match, Luxol captain Mark Zammit was presented with the Super Cup trophy by Dr Matthew Paris, the Malta FA vice-president who oversees the futsal sector. Dr Paris was accompanied by FMA official Mireille Vella.
